A meeting of the minds, the Obstructures x EAE Bass Driver is Christmas morning for fans of beloved vintage Canadian bass amplifiers or either company involved. Falling in line with their previous collaboration, this sleek, clean, and blissfully simple pedal punches in for a unique effect experience spurred on by the pair's effect expertise.

The front face of this collaboration features four sliders: Volume, Gain, Bass, and Attack. Highly interactive with one another, these controls are precise and expressive for getting to the heart of your own thunderous bass mixes. In the event you're not looking to blow the doors down, Obstructures and Electronic Audio Experiments have you covered there, too. While the Bass Driver's Volume slider can get very (very) loud alongside the Drive slider's fifty decibels of maximum passband gain, this pedal also has a softer, more considered side that can be rolled in with accompanying Bass and Attack controls. Getting into the closest of characters with the Bass Driver is deceptively easy, though of course, the capacity for disaster (driven by a formidable burst of volume on tap perhaps) is always afoot.

As a barebones ode to bass amplification's greatest, this collaboration between Obstructures and Electronic Audio Experiments proves once again that teamwork makes the dream work, or great minds think alike, or any number of those kinds of platitudes that you can imagine. In any case, it's a knockout.

  • Limited collaboration design between Obstructures and Electronic Audio Experiments
  • Four volume and tone-shaping sliders
  • Internal notch filter switch
  • Standard nine-volt DC center negative power operation
